Jobs/Vacancies › Re: Nigerian Army SSC And DSSC 2016/2017 Forum by akinyemmzy(m): 4:38am On Mar 31, 2021 |
Gentlemen I feel I need to write this to boost your morale, it can be very sad and painful after going through so much stress and rigour of the screening only not to be selected. I can only imagine what it took a whole lot of you just to even be present, the joy alone from friends, family, spouses and girlfriends that you were selected for interview only to be dropped. Gentlemen do not give up, if the system looks flawed to you the way and manner u beat the system is entirely your business.
I personally came for 64RC,65RC,66RC,67RC SSC 45 and 46. I was bitter all through until 46 and guess what I only discovered that it was God's appointed time. As a matter fact I would have regretted a whole lot of things if I had be selected in the other courses. God factor extremely important.
Be grateful for your current position, be grateful for where you are now. Be grateful you are alive. As a matter of fact how would your parents feel after gaining admission and they learnt you died, Got blind or got injured during the training and was sent back home. Such happened Gentlemen and the psychological effects alone I can only imagine. ACA is not a childs play as you are trained physically and emotionally to kill and go through possibly the most difficult and trying times of your life. I have very Good friends here and they never Give up. @Ugo4u is an example.The joy of wanting to become an officer guides your foresight narrowly to not know what is ahead of you, some will do better than being in the Army, do not loose hope.
The Army is optimistic about your Generation, success is sweeter when there is failure. Congratulations to those selected, we will be seeing more often than none,I only wish you know what is coming your way and maybe u might just survive. The earlier you make up your mind there the better. Pls carry nothing less than 10-15 blue shorts and if possible 15- 20 white shirts. If you are using a size 44 please buy a size 45 or 46 canvas( 2 size ahead of your initial size) buy a canvas u can wash easily and pls buy like 3 canvas and sow it round. Prepare you mind and I wish u all the best. Feel free to message if u need any help, guidance or have a question. |

ugo4u: My Odyssey at Ibadan for the Nigerian Army Screening DSSC Course 25 As you all know I wasn’t shortlisted for the interview, it was quite disappointing but deep within me I had already made-up my mind to gatecrash the goddamn venue. I communicated my intentions to some nairalanders who had similar issues with me though it was only one that finally turned up ( @KennethNnolim). On the 1st of November I resigned my job (infact I sacked myself) to avoid unnecessary begging from my colleagues that might result in me changing my mind. My mind was so made up that for a second I didn’t even give a thought not to be at Ibadan bad as e bad them go lock me up for guardroom, nobody will kill me. Hence the reason why I said “If I perish I perish”. I was damned determined to challenge the odds. I only told my family about my journey an hour to departure time(my people self just kuku tire for me, they could feel the undying zeal in me), headed straight for my home state to get all my documents intact, came back to Kaduna gathered all my salala and headed straight for Ibadan were I connected with kennethnnolim one of the silent observers on this thread. Before I continue let me talk about this guy, I do think I have passion for this job not until I met this guy, his physique is something else infact when we entered the screening venue both officers and men couldn’t ignore him more than four personnel approached him at different times that he is the type of person they need now, they imagined him handling a GPMG not one not two soldiers at different occasion made such comment, the guy for me is Nigerian Arnold Schwasnegger, if na fitness the guy dey, if na credentials everything is complete but una sabi as naija thing dey bi, it is people that are less passionate about the job that are most atimes shortlisted. Infact a medical consultant and a lawyer withdrew from the exercise they said they weren’t interested again, the funny thing was that the army guys were begging the lawyer to stay baba say he is no longer interested, they even told him that he will be paid upto 300k per month just to convince him to stay baba drop tag jaapa. One other lady that came six days into the screening was even disinterested in the process it was the soldiers that even drag her sef some of her documents where even photocopied by the soldiers, her course wasn’t even advertised in the first place, I spoke to her how comes she told me she wasn’t even shortlisted that it was her uncle a senior officer that sent her(she wasn’t interested at all). Now back to my story, I stormed Ibadan 2 days before the exercise commenced and I was graciously hosted by Kenneth and from his house we drew our battle plan, we worked out all possible scenarios and how to approach it, omo it was like we were planning a bank heist every details was penned down and well plotted for execution. On the 8th of November we “stormed Fajuyi Cantonment” like commandoes, we had already sorted out accommodation within the barracks so we headed straight for mechanic workshop block where soldiers live with their families . One of the major thing that struck me is the obvious emptiness in the entire barracks most of the soldiers have been shipped to the northeast, its only children and women that you see around infact I don’t think soldiers at the entire cantonment are more than 100. This is a barrack that is bigger than NDA old site and new site, little wonder they massively increased the intake this year, the NA really need hands. On the D-day of screening we gallantly stormed the venue (stadium) flanked by the heavily built Kenneth even me sef wore body hug white na that day me sef realize say I get small chest and confirm 6 packs, Kenneth bounced majestically to the admiration of most of the personnel, we introduced ourselves and explained our situation to them, begging them to give us a chance at least to prove ourselves before the board, since we are eminently qualified all our credentials including professional certifications where intact, impressed by our determination the personnel in charge of documentation directed us to wait within the venue directly opposite candidates that have being screened and given tags(those of una wey go Ibadan must have seen us chilling opposite una) we were about thirty in number that where “Special candidates” amongst us some received text directly from MS office, others Senators/HOR members while another set where gate crashers( about four of us). As the screening went on we were assured that we will be attended to depending on the turn-up in our respective states, the board secretary Lt Col. Abang was nice to us, we were even eating with regular candidates; infact some of the candidates were murmuring because they felt we posed great danger to their chances( who won’t be scared sha). As days went on our hopes began to wither from about thirty, eleven where left some went back home in anger, why some who made call to senior men where allowed to join up, infact we were watching when two guys one from Bauchi and another from Zamfara where being looked for by the screening officers, I later heard a call came in from Headquaters. I and Kenneth with about three other guys held on till the last moment hoping for a miracle but unfortunately the officers changed their mind the board secretary really wanted to help but his hands were tied as senior officers flooded the venue. One lady soldier sent from Abuja for the exercise met us secretly and told us that at that point we should call any senior officer preferably a senior to the board chairman that we will be allowed she said it was that easy cos many have entered via that route. Some states had in excess of 45 candidates as against 35 published, the padding no get part two. The soldiers wanted to smuggle us in but the problem was that the board chairman was already familiar with our faces he has interacted with us previously, they insisted we have a backup or someone to recommend us to join up. At that point I tried reaching my contacts but non worked out, the board secretary and other officers stopped picking calls. Ladies and gentlemen na so I take pack my salala after medicals come back house but overall the experience was worth it, I never regretted anything one bit very valuable lessons were learnt, my eyes where opened to many things, as far as the dssc is concerned it is very competitive lobby-wise, the percentage of merit will be low compared to SSC according to some of the officers I spoke to they said those are the once they need enmass, anyone that faces board(SSC) have 80% chances of making the list some dssc guys that are young will be pushed to SSC, a lot of hands is needed in the northeast, even most of DSSC course 24 guys that passed out this year where posted to the northeast, their SSC colleagues(War guys) are doing their regimentation course in Yobe state. In all they said they only need about 300 cadets for training and about 600 made the cut after medicals this is excluding those that later joined up and those that will join up for training in Jaji that weren’t even present for the screening. May God see us all through in the pursuit of our dreams. I wish all DSSC 25/SSC 46 guys who faced the board SUCCESS.
